When to go to Disney World.

Orlando has many different seasons, some of which offer more values than others. The shoulder seasons of April/May and October are excellent times to visit Orlando. Not only are there fewer crowds and a high likelihood of sunny and warm weather, but special deals tend to be widely available. The value seasons in Orlando generally occur after New Year's until mid-February, mid-August through early October, and from after Thanksgiving through mid-December. Holidays, spring break and summer are considered to be high seasons and prices tend to be significantly higher during these time periods. Make sure to also consider the weather when you plan your vacation. July and August tend to be the hottest and rainiest months, November through January are the coldest months, and hurricane season in Florida generally occurs from July through mid-October.
